Pia Zaunmair is a scholar working on Developmental Neuroscience, Molecular Biology and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Pia Zaunmair has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 315 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Developmental Neuroscience, 5 papers in Molecular Biology and 4 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Pia Zaunmair’s work include Neurogenesis and neuroplasticity mechanisms (6 papers), Axon Guidance and Neuronal Signaling (4 papers) and Spinal Cord Injury Research (3 papers). Pia Zaunmair is often cited by papers focused on Neurogenesis and neuroplasticity mechanisms (6 papers), Axon Guidance and Neuronal Signaling (4 papers) and Spinal Cord Injury Research (3 papers). Pia Zaunmair collaborates with scholars based in Austria, Germany and Spain. Pia Zaunmair's co-authors include Sébastien Couillard‐Després, Christina Kreutzer, Ludwig Aigner, Lara Bieler and Peter Rotheneichner and has published in prestigious journals such as Scientific Reports, Cerebral Cortex and Molecules.
